Review: Yesterday I called and asked about a pickup truck price. I was quoted 33,500. Today I called to see if there was any change in he pricing and was told 37,500 right out of the gate. When I revealed to the sales ant that I had gotten a 33,500 price the previous day, he back pedaled quickly and said that the owner had hired in a special sales team that jacked all the prices up for the next 4 days; however, since he had spoken with me yesterday; he was still willing to honor the previous day's price. Why the same salesman if a new team had been hired? Seemed quite fishy to me.Desired Settlement: Just to warn other consumers or fishy sales tactics.

Every vehicle has suggested retail pricing that is first quoted as

a starting point to ultimately show the value of our discounted pricing

structure, and every vehicle can be negotiated down and/or offered for a

minimum acceptable price. The salesman did right by quoting the $37,500

suggested retail, his only mistake was not realizing he had the same customer

on the phone that he had previously offered a lower minimum price to. And

the salesperson used a very poor choice of words in a haste to

conceal his own ignorance.

I do have an outside company here this week. I think it is

the best thing I’ve ever done for my customers – everyone that comes in gets a

prize, I even gave a car away at this same sale last year. However I do

not allow “jacking” of prices or “fishy” sales tactics. Actually, I take

offense to that suggestion. I have been here 24 years and have always

been proud to run an honest, friendly, and reputable dealership. I rest

well at night knowing that I enjoy going to public places and am able to talk

to all my customers with a handshake and a smile.

Review: I recently purchased a vehicle from Jim Harris after a week had gone by I discovered that I was charged six thousand dollars more that the vehicle is worth. I called to speak with the onwer and was hung up on without an explanation. It is really ironic that the day I purchased the vehicle he personally came out and gave me a hug a couple of weeks later I contact the owner for an explanition and he hangs up on me, how rude and disrespectful for the owner to act this way. This is going to make great PR in the coming weeks.Desired Settlement: I am willing to keep the vehicle and pay for it but pay six thousand dollars more without a legit explanation is out of the question.

Buying a car is a negotiated process that is mutually agrrrd upon and not forced on anyone. I have been here over 20 years and have never had a complaint such as this and I go to the Warrenton stores and out in public without having to worry about running into anyone who is upset with my dealership. I both live and do business in this community and am certainly not going to run a shady business not just because I live her but because it is the right thing to do.

There's many ways on the internet to compile "values" for used vehicles, they are all just guides that have to be subject to common sense individual evaluation. I paid over "book value" for [redacted] vehicle because I know the person that I got it from and I know how they took care of it. The vehicle was immaculate and worth much more than average.

We allowed [redacted] $[redacted]. for her trade that was wholesaled for its true value of $[redacted].

After doing the maath above, yes that leaves some profit, chich I use to pay a considerable amount of local, state and federal taxes, as well as charity in my community and generously take care of 16 employees so them and their families can also promote the communitys economy.

I will not be refunding any of what little is left of my profit.
